You needed a break. Everyone around you was starting to make you agitated. You smiled to everyone as you made your way to the nearest exit, but on the inside, you were yelling at every single one of them. You slipped out of the house and away from all the people.

You shouldered on your sweater as you walked down the sidewalk towards the outskirts of town. There was a river that went around the edge of the city limits, and you loved sitting on the bridge looking into the rushing water.

You walked, in no particular hurry, to the bridge.  There were no cars that night, but you noticed someone sitting along the rail of the bridge. You stopped right next to him.

He looked not even 20, but you couldn't be sure. He was tough looking, with a leather jacket and a stone cold expression on his moonlit face. His hair looked pale, like a very light blonde (I describe him like the book sorry).

"If you jump, then I'll have to jump too," you stated, breaking through the fragile silence.

The stranger turned towards you, and you took in his handsome features and icy, blue eyes. "Now, why would you do that?"

You sighed and leaned against the rail, looking out on the rushing water beneath you. "My life is a constant battle between my sanity and my surroundings. Nothing goes right, and I'm just done trying."

"Well," he started, "I'm Dallas, and you are?"

"Giving up. Screaming on the inside. Tired of not being adequate. Take your pick," you replied. "But most people call me Kyla."

You both sat there in silence for a few moments. The only sounds were the water, the distant horns from the cars in town, and the sound of your and Dallas's breathing.

"Why are you here?" you decided to break the silence again. You turned to face Dallas.

"I guess, I'm here because I needed another option." He kept his gaze on the moving river. "I'm a lost cause, a delinquent, a dirty hood. Take your pick." He let out a little laugh at his reference to what you had said before.

"I don't think you are," you stated.

"You don't even know me."

You looked at him dead in the eye and words just fell out. "I don't have to."

The next thing you knew, both of your lips were connected in a kiss. He cupped your face in his hands, holding you to the kiss, as if he needed to. You both pulled away to catch your breath.

He leaned his forehead against yours. "I think you're worth living for."

"Ditto." You reconnected your lips to his.
